Xcode-beta (6E7): File Inspector doesn't support multiple selection

Summary: I have a bunch of source files (XIBs) that were not members of a target and want to add them to the same targets, and have to do it explicitly for each file. Steps to Reproduce: - Select 25 XIB files in the project navigator. - Switch to the File Inspector Expected Results: The File Inspector should show the "Target membership" section. The files are all XIBs after all, so eligible for adding. I should be able to just check one particular target's checkmark to add all 25 XIBs to this one target. Actual Results: The "Target membership" section is missing. It is only visible when I select a single file. I have to manually select each file, switch to the File Inspector again and tick the checkbox there (which takes quite a while to react, too). Please fix this, thanks.
